Artist Commissions

A call-out to artists with an exciting new digital commissioning opportunity

Earlier this year, we invited South West artists to come up with creative digital responses to the challenges of lockdown, focusing on the most vulnerable in our communities, parents trying to home-school children, socially-isolated people, and key workers.

We called that initiative THE TIME IS NOW and the resulting works, including podcasts, a community choir, a digital conversation about hanging around, an online game, and a circus film about mental health that has gone on to win awards, can now all be seen here.

We hoped that the impact of lockdown would have lessened by now, but it’s clear that this disruption to the creative and cultural life of the country is going to continue for some time, and that there’s now a pressing need to reflect on what the last six months have taught us about ourselves, our society, and the changes that are needed when we finally emerge from this crisis.  

We’re therefore launching a new initiative called THE TIME (FOR CHANGE) IS NOW, with three further £1,000 commissions for artists to create original digital works reflecting on this.

We’re particularly keen to hear from you if you’ve experienced barriers to getting involved in creative projects in the past, or you feel like your voice and ideas haven’t been heard within Devon as loudly as they should; this is your chance to help us change that.

Send us your pitch, which could be written (a side of A4), a video/audio file (up to 5 mins) or a combination of both – tell us about your idea; your target audience; who else will be involved; when it’ll happen; and how you’re going to ensure it’s inclusive.
